Daily cleansing is the basis for a successful beauty regimen. Over time, the surface gathers dirt, sebum, and pollutants, if left unchecked, often result in breakouts, lack of radiance, and skin issues. Cleansing eliminates these impurities, guaranteeing a clean complexion. However, it’s crucial to use a non-irritating face wash appropriate for one’s skin type so as not to cause over-drying. Using harsh cleansers can deplete natural oils, resulting in inflammation. Those with delicate skin should opt for hypoallergenic formulas. People prone to shine benefit from foaming cleansers that regulate oil without overcompensating. Hydrating cream-based cleansers are ideal for dehydrated skin, maintaining hydration while cleansing.

Facial oils have gained popularity for their skin-replenishing properties. Compared to lotions and creams, plant-based oils deliver nutrients more effectively to provide intense nourishment. Ingredients such as squalane oil, packed with essential fatty acids, help to repair. If you have acne-prone skin, fast-absorbing oils including grapeseed moisturize without clogging pores. Skin prone to dehydration benefit from nutrient-dense oils like moringa, which restore moisture. Adding a beauty oil as a final step supports a plump complexion, leading to soft, healthy-looking skin.
